Publisher's Synopsis

This book demonstrates how microcomputer technology may be applied to social science research in psychology, education, sociology, political science, health sciences and information science. The authors draw upon their experience in the field to provide the reader with a step-by-step guide to carrying out research, preparing reports and disseminating data through the use of computers.;Case studies are provided throughout, along with demonstrations of the use of computers to produce effective grant applications. The book covers meta analysis, power analysis and choosing appropriate packages, and also lists popular software packages applicable to research tasks.
